ROCKERBOX 2012
This years Rockerbox Motofest and Street Party was the biggest yet!
With the attendance growing every year since its inception 10 years ago, this premiere Wisconsin motorcycle event is an option to those who don’t want to be lost in a sea of cookie cutter bikes.
Tim Schneider of The Shop and Scott Johnson of The Fuel Cafe started this one day show all those years ago and I happened to be in attendance, and from humble beginnings come great things.
There is a official bike show as well as just the bikes parked on the street, the categories range from best cafe, choppers,American,British,European,Japanese best of show and the coveted cool as fuck award. Last years attendance saw 2000+ bikes and 7000-8000 people long way from the 100 or so local guys from the first one.
But the spirit is still the same a lot of good folks getting together for a good time and to see some beautiful bikes and help out the Steel Shoe Fund for down and hurt racers.
So gawk at the photos and if you like what you see check out the scene in person the first sat in Aug 2013 on Center St. in the river west neighborhood of Milwaukee.
